TIA-455-204

FOTP-204 Measurement of Bandwidth on Multimode Fiber

scope:

This document describes two methods for determining and measuring the information transmission capacity of TIA/EIA-4920000-B Class I (glass core) multi-mode optical fibers. The baseband frequency response is directly measured in the frequency domain by determining the fiber response to a sinusoidally modulated light source. The baseband response can also be measured by observing the broadening of a narrow pulse of light. The two methods are:

Method A - Optical Time Domain Measurement Method (Pulse Distortion)

Method B - Frequency Domain Measurement Method

Each method can be performed using one of two launches: an overfilled launch (OFL) condition or a restricted mode launch (RML) condition.

Note: These test methods are commonly used in production and research facilities and are not easily accomplished in the field.
